#!/usr/bin/env python
# -*- coding: utf-8 -*-
"""Unit tests for arXiv provider
This file is part of paper2remarkable.
"""
import os
import re
import shutil
import tempfile
import unittest
from paper2remarkable.providers.arxiv import (
DEARXIV_TEXT_REGEX,
DEARXIV_URI_REGEX,
Arxiv,
)
class TestArxiv(unittest.TestCase):
@classmethod
def setUpClass(cls):
cls.original_dir = os.getcwd()
def setUp(self):
self.test_dir = tempfile.mkdtemp()
os.chdir(self.test_dir)
def tearDown(self):
os.chdir(self.original_dir)
shutil.rmtree(self.test_dir)
def test_text_regex_1(self):
key = b"arXiv:1908.03213v1 [astro.HE] 8 Aug 2019"
m = re.fullmatch(DEARXIV_TEXT_REGEX, key)
self.assertIsNotNone(m)
def test_text_regex_2(self):
key = b"arXiv:1908.03213v1 [astro-ph.HE] 8 Aug 2019"
m = re.fullmatch(DEARXIV_TEXT_REGEX, key)
self.assertIsNotNone(m)
def test_text_regex_3(self):
key = b"arXiv:physics/0605197v1 [physics.data-an] 23 May 2006"
m = re.fullmatch(DEARXIV_TEXT_REGEX, key)
self.assertIsNotNone(m)
def test_text_regex_4(self):
key = b"arXiv:math/0309285v2 [math.NA] 9 Apr 2004"
m = re.fullmatch(DEARXIV_TEXT_REGEX, key)
self.assertIsNotNone(m)
def test_uri_regex_1(self):
key = b"http://arxiv.org/abs/physics/0605197v1"
m = re.fullmatch(DEARXIV_URI_REGEX, key)
self.assertIsNotNone(m)
def test_uri_regex_2(self):
key = b"https://arxiv.org/abs/1101.0028v3"
m = re.fullmatch(DEARXIV_URI_REGEX, key)
self.assertIsNotNone(m)
def test_stamp_removed_1(self):
url = "https://arxiv.org/pdf/1703.06103.pdf"
prov = Arxiv(upload=False)
filename = prov.run(url, filename="./target.pdf")
prov.uncompress_pdf(filename, "unc.pdf")
with open("unc.pdf", "rb") as fp:
data = fp.read()
self.assertNotIn(b"arXiv:1703.06103v4 [stat.ML] 26 Oct 2017", data)
def test_stamp_removed_2(self):
url = "https://arxiv.org/abs/2003.06222"
prov = Arxiv(upload=False)
filename = prov.run(url, filename="./target.pdf")
prov.uncompress_pdf(filename, "unc.pdf")
with open("unc.pdf", "rb") as fp:
data = fp.read()
self.assertNotIn(b"arXiv:2003.06222v1 [stat.ML] 13 Mar 2020", data)
def test_stamp_removed_3(self):
url = "https://arxiv.org/abs/physics/0605197v1"
prov = Arxiv(upload=False)
filename = prov.run(url, filename="./target.pdf")
prov.uncompress_pdf(filename, "unc.pdf")
with open("unc.pdf", "rb") as fp:
data = fp.read()
self.assertNotIn(
b"arXiv:physics/0605197v1 [physics.data-an] 23 May 2006", data
)
self.assertNotIn(
b"/URI (http://arxiv.org/abs/physics/0605197v1)", data
)
def test_stamp_removed_4(self):
url = "https://arxiv.org/abs/math/0309285v2"
prov = Arxiv(upload=False)
filename = prov.run(url, filename="./target.pdf")
prov.uncompress_pdf(filename, "unc.pdf")
with open("unc.pdf", "rb") as fp:
data = fp.read()
self.assertNotIn(b"arXiv:math/0309285v2 [math.NA] 9 Apr 2004", data)
self.assertNotIn(b"/URI (http://arXiv.org/abs/math/0309285v2)", data)
def test_stamp_removed_5(self):
url = "https://arxiv.org/abs/astro-ph/9207001v1"
prov = Arxiv(upload=False)
filename = prov.run(url, filename="./target.pdf")
prov.uncompress_pdf(filename, "unc.pdf")
with open("unc.pdf", "rb") as fp:
data = fp.read()
self.assertNotIn(
b"/URI (http://arxiv.org/abs/astro-ph/9207001v1)", data
)
if __name__ == "__main__":
unittest.main()
